General Information:

Releases: The workshop fee will include a NON-COMMERCIAL use release. You will be able to display images taken at the workshop in your printed and online portfolios, but you will not be able to use them commercially. If you wish to get a commercial release you must negotiate this seperately with each model. Otherwise, the images you take must only be used for your portfolio.
